Graduates of University of Southern Indiana's bachelor's program in Rehabilitation and Therapeutic Professions earn a median $45,953 one year after graduating, rising to $81,625 by year ten. Five years out, earnings run 35% above the national median of $55,287 for this field, ranking 22nd of 72 reporting programs.

Source: U.S. Census Bureau PSEO, release V4.13.0 2025Q4. Earnings are for graduates working in covered states; figures are medians in nominal dollars.
